However, Fortnite's best deal has yet to come, as a survey from Epic Games has leaked on Twitter, shared by well-known Fortnite leaker FireMonkey . The survey was sent out via email to a handful of players asking different questions regarding a possible subscription service coming to Fortnite in the future. The service seems to be called the " Monthly Crew Pack " and includes the current season's Battle Pass, early access to a skin set, and a monthly supply of 1,000 V-Bucks. One of the main questions on the survey is how much players are willing to pay for this service with multiple choice answers ranging from $4.99 to $18

Fortnite on Xbox Series X __ is more impressive when it comes to its visuals. The game now has an option to add a frame counter to the screen, which confirms that it runs at 60fps, even at 4K resolution. Fortnite looks great on Xbox Series X, with shadows and reflective surfaces looking crisper than ever, the storm clouds looking prettier (even when running away from them), and the only pop-in occurred when descending to the island at high speed after jumping from the Battle Bus. With that being said, the overall comic book feel of Fortnite means that the visual upgrades aren't as apparent as some other titles on Xbox Series X, like Devil May Cry 5: Special Edition. At first, it would seem absurd for Fortnite to offer players this package at a price as low as $5. The Battle Pass alone costs roughly $10, an entire skin set can cost anywhere from $15 to $25, and 1,000 V-Bucks is another $8 . Even if the subscription service ends up costing the full $19, players are still saving a minimum of $14. If this service does come to fruition, it's a no-brainer purchase for the dedicated Fortnite player base.
